CADD Manager

Location: Minneapolis, MN
Salary Range: $120,000 – $140,000


Full-time | Hybrid Flexibility | Leadership Opportunity

Shape the Future of Digital Design Operations

Are you ready to lead the digital backbone of design and engineering operations? We’re looking for a highly skilled CAD Manager to guide and grow a thriving team of engineering professionals and support design workflows across transportation, infrastructure, and community-building projects.

This is more than a technical role, it's a strategic leadership opportunity at the intersection of design technology, team development, and operational excellence.

What You’ll Do:

As the CADD Manager, you’ll take charge of digital design platforms and workflows across multiple business units. Your responsibilities will include:

Technical Leadership

  • Champion enterprise CAD technology including Autodesk, Bentley, ProjectWise, and integrated applications
  • Evaluate workflows and implement solutions that support evolving project and software requirements
  • Lead troubleshooting and serve as the go-to expert for complex application issues and escalations
  • Ensure consistent and quality project setups aligned with client expectations

Team Leadership

  • Provide mentorship and leadership to the digital design teams
  • Define objectives and performance metrics for team members, manage workloads, and resolve internal challenges
  • Promote cross-training and skill development to build team resiliency

Training & Onboarding

  • Develop and deliver training programs for CAD users
  • Launch and manage a designer onboarding curriculum, ensuring new hires are fully equipped to succeed
  • Create and maintain a library of training documentation and materials

Vendor and Partner Management

  • Manage vendor relationships with Autodesk, Bentley, and other providers to ensure tools meet organizational needs
  • Oversee licensing and usage alignment to maintain efficiency and compliance
  • Collaborate with IT to ensure performance, security, and system uptime

Strategic Initiatives

  • Develop and implement the long-term roadmap for CAD applications in alignment with broader business goals
  • Establish and track KPIs
  • Lead cross-functional technology initiatives that drive innovation and operational improvements

What You Bring:

  • Previous experience managing Autodesk and Bentley product suites
  • Familiarity with DOT standards (MN, ND, WI preferred)
  • Project management and problem-solving skills
  • Experience leading high-performance teams
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ills
  • Working knowledge of document management, learning management, and file-sharing systems
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ite
  • Detail-oriented, highly organized, and motivated by continuous improvement
